.popup-container-main{display:none;opacity:0}.popup-container-main.show{display:flex;opacity:1}.vsl-popup-container-main .meetings-iframe-container{margin-bottom:-.5rem!important;padding-bottom:0;position:relative;z-index:1}.vsl-popup-container-main .popup-container{border-radius:6px!important;padding:.2rem 1rem 0!important}.vsl-popup-container-main .popup-close{align-items:center;background:#fff;border:1px solid #bebebe;border-radius:50%;color:#0a162f;display:flex;height:1.8rem;justify-content:center;padding:.3rem;position:absolute;right:-.6rem;top:-.7rem;width:1.8rem}.vsl-popup-container-main .pop-container-parent{width:100%}.vsl-popup-container-main .popup-container{background:#fff;border-radius:5;box-shadow:0 10px 25px rgba(0,0,0,.1);margin:1rem auto;max-height:inherit;max-width:720px;overflow-y:initial;padding:1.5rem;position:relative;width:100%}.popup-container-main{align-items:center;animation:fadeIn .3s ease-out 0s 1 normal none running;background:#292b2eb0;box-shadow:0 10px 30px rgba(0,0,0,.15);height:100vh;justify-content:center;left:50%;max-width:100;overflow-y:scroll;position:fixed;top:50%;transform:translate(-50%,-50%);width:100%;z-index:1000}.popup-header-image img{height:65px;margin:0 auto 1.2rem;width:65px}.popup-heading{color:#0a162f;font-size:clamp(1.25rem,4vw,1.5rem);font-weight:700;line-height:1.3;margin-bottom:.75rem}.popup-subheading p{color:#0a162f;font-size:15px;line-height:1.5;margin-bottom:.8rem;margin-top:.8rem}.popup-subheading li{color:#4a5568;margin-bottom:.5rem}.popup-subheading li svg{flex-shrink:0;height:18px;margin-right:.5rem;margin-top:.15rem;width:18px}.popup-subheading li{align-items:flex-start;color:#0a162f;display:flex;font-size:13px;line-height:1.4;margin-bottom:0}.popup-subheading li:not(:last-child){margin-bottom:.5rem}.popup-form-container{margin:1.25rem 0}.popup-form-container form{display:flex;flex-direction:column}.popup-form-container input,.popup-form-container textarea{border:1px solid #e2e8f0;border-radius:6px;box-sizing:border-box;font-size:clamp(.9rem,3vw,1rem);padding:.75rem;width:100%}.popup-form-container button{background-color:#3182ce;font-size:clamp(.95rem,3vw,1rem);font-weight:600;transition:background-color .2s}.cta-button,.popup-form-container button{border:none;border-radius:6px;color:#fff;cursor:pointer;padding:.75rem}.cta-button{background-color:#38a169;font-size:clamp(1rem,3.5vw,1.1rem);font-weight:700;margin:1.25rem 0;text-align:center;transition:all .2s;width:100%}@media (min-width:768px){.popup-container{padding:2rem}.popup-subheading li svg{height:13px;width:13px}.cta-button,.popup-form-container{margin:1.5rem 0}.cta-button{padding:1rem}}@media (max-width:480px){.popup-container{padding:1.25rem;width:95%}.popup-heading{font-size:1.3rem}.popup-subheading li svg{height:16px;width:16px}.popup-form-container input,.popup-form-container textarea{padding:.65rem}}.cta-button:hover,.popup-form-container button:hover{opacity:.9;transform:translateY(-1px)}.popup-form-container input:focus,.popup-form-container textarea:focus{border-color:#3182ce;box-shadow:0 0 0 2px rgba(49,130,206,.2);outline:none}.popup-close{background:none;border:none;color:#718096;cursor:pointer;font-size:1.5rem;padding:.5rem;position:absolute;right:.5rem;top:.5rem;transition:color .2s;z-index:10}.popup-close:hover{color:#1a1a1a}.popup-close svg{height:1.25rem;width:1.25rem}.secondary-link{color:#718096;cursor:pointer;display:block;font-size:clamp(.8rem,3vw,.875rem);margin-top:.5rem;text-decoration:underline}.popup-bottom-text-line p,.secondary-link{text-align:center}.hs-button.primary.large{background-color:#ef21ad;border:1px solid #ef21ad!important;border-radius:20px!important;color:#fff;font-size:15px!important;margin-top:1rem}.popup-form-main-heading{font-size:28px;line-height:32px;margin-bottom:.5rem;text-align:center}.popup-form-subheaing{font-size:17px;line-height:1.25;text-align:center}.popup-form-container input{border:1px solid hsla(207,4%,52%,.5)!important;border-radius:20px!important}.popup-note p{font-size:15px;line-height:1.6;margin-top:.8rem}.popup-bottom-text-line p{font-size:15px;margin:0}.popup-subheading ul{background:#eee;border-radius:9px;list-style:none;margin:.4rem 0;padding:.45rem}.popup-header-image img{background:#ffe4f7;border-radius:8px;border-radius:50%;display:block;height:auto;height:55px;margin:0 auto .9rem;object-fit:cover;padding:.8rem;width:55px}